【目的】本文主要探讨铅中毒对儿童甲状腺功能的影响。【方法】入选对象为0~6岁的儿童,血铅采用钨舟原子吸收光谱法测定,并根据血铅的水平<100μg/L,100~200μg/L,200~499μg/L将儿童分为正常血铅组、轻度铅中毒组和中度铅中毒组。对三组对象均采用化学发光免疫技术,分别测其TT3、TT4、FT3、FT4、TSH共5项甲状腺功能指标,并计算出FT4/TSH的比值,将三组甲状腺功能指标和FT4/TSH的比值进行方差分析。【结果】正常血铅组、轻度铅中毒组和中度铅中毒组TT3、TT4、FT3、FT4值差异均无显著性,而三组的TSH值,FT4/TSH比值存在显著性差异。【结论】虽然未达到甲状腺功能低下的程度,但是轻中度铅中毒对儿童甲状腺功能已存在影响;并且随着血中铅浓度的增高,甲状腺功能损害的程度也会加重。  相似文献

Seventy-two female rhesus monkeys were randomly assigned to three lead exposure conditions (none, birth to 1 year, birth to 2 years). In a completely crossed design, the lead-exposed and control monkeys were randomized to placebo or chelation therapy which began at 1 year of age. Dosing was conducted daily beginning on day 8 postpartum. The lead dose levels were adjusted biweekly to gradually elevate the blood lead level of each monkey to a target of 1.69-1.93 micromol/L (35-40 microg/dL). Succimer (or placebo) was administered orally (30 mg/kg/day for 5 days and 20 mg/kg/day for 14 additional days) for a total 19-day treatment regimen. There were two separate chelation regimes at 53 and 65 weeks of age. Succimer therapy in combination with lead abatement reduced blood lead levels significantly faster than lead abatement alone; however, that advantage disappeared once succimer therapy was discontinued. Weight, crown-rump length, and head circumference were measured regularly. Growth in weight, length, and head circumference did not vary significantly as a function of blood lead levels. Succimer chelation therapy did not significantly affect weight, length, or head circumference through 2 years of age.  相似文献

目的 探讨二巯基丁二酸(又名二巯琥珀酸,DMSA)治疗慢性中度铅中毒幼兔的驱铅效果.方法 24 只离乳(45 d)雄性健康新西兰幼兔,数字表法随机分为治疗组、阳性对照组和阴性对照组,每组8只,经消化道染铅(醋酸铅,每天5 mg/kg) 6周复制中度铅中毒动物模型,然后给予DMSA 驱铅治疗,第1周每天给DMSA 1050 mg/m2 体表面积,然后改为每天700 mg/m2 体表面积连续2周,停药3周,每周采集血液和尿液,12周后杀死并取海马、睾丸、心脏、肝脏、肾脏和脾脏.用原子吸收分光光谱仪测定血铅,电感耦合等离子体质谱仪测尿铅和组织脏器铅,光学显微镜(简称光镜)下观察组织脏器的组织结构.结果 与阳性对照组(PG)相比,DMSA 治疗组(TG)的幼兔展尿铅浓度增加显著,从治疗前的(40.97±1.77)μg/L 显著增加至达到峰值 (1246.96±157.91)μg/L,然后逐步减少,第1周两组相比差异有统计学意义(F=2934.35,P<0.01),三组间相比较差异均具有统计学意义(P值均<0.01);同时血铅水平(blood lead levels,BLLs)在用药后由治疗前的(429.63±10.82)μg/L,锐减到第3周停药时的(238.50±11.82)μg/L,停药后出现一过性反弹,然后再次降低;而PG的BLLs在同时期中呈现缓慢下降过程,到停药3周后为(149.88 4±11.39)μg/L,基本接近于TG的(135.50±7.09)μg/L.TG新西兰兔的组织脏器铅含量显著降低,体重增长明显加快,光镜下观察睾丸和肝脏的病理损伤有一定程度的改善.结论 DMSA 治疗慢性中度铅中毒幼兔,可以快速有效降低血铅和软组织铅,在短时间内减轻铅对组织脏器的毒性作用,使组织脏器的损伤随着机体铅负荷的降低而有所减轻,对铅毒性作用导致的生长发育落后有一定的改善作用.  相似文献

2141名学龄前儿童血铅水平调查研究   总被引:2,自引:0,他引:2  
目的:了解丰台区目前学龄前儿童血铅水平,为制定积极有效的干预措施提供科学依据。方法:采取整群分层随机抽样的方法,选择北京市丰台区6所城区幼儿园和6所农村幼儿园在园2~6岁儿童2 141名,采用阳极溶出分析法测定血铅水平。结果:丰台区学龄前儿童血铅水平均数为73.90μg/L,其中铅中毒发生率为10.46%;儿童血铅水平存在显著的性别差异,男童铅中毒发生率高于女童,且具有统计意义;血铅水平以2岁组儿童血铅水平最高;儿童血铅水平无显著的地域差异,城市儿童血铅水平和血铅≥100μg/L的发生率与农村儿童无差别(P>0.05)。结论:目前丰台区儿童铅中毒绝大多数处于轻中度铅中毒水平,应采取积极、多样的健康宣教等干预措施防治儿童铅中毒。  相似文献

目的通过调查顺德大良地区2 285例3~6岁儿童末梢血铅水平,为制定相关公共卫生政策提供依据。方法采集大良2 285例3~6岁儿童末梢血,用电感耦合高频等离子发射光谱法进行血铅检测,并对检测结果进行统计学处理。结果 2 285例学龄前儿童血铅水平为(44.77±17.73)μg/L,铅中毒率1.8%,以轻度铅中毒为主。统计分析显示不同性别儿童铅中毒率比较及城乡间儿童铅中毒率比较,差异均有统计学意义(P0.05)。男童铅中毒率高于女童(P0.05);农村儿童铅中毒率高于城镇儿童(P0.01)。结论重点关注农村地区儿童的铅中毒防治;提高居民环保意识,保障儿童健康成长。  相似文献

儿童血铅含量调查分析   总被引:1,自引:0,他引:1  
目的 筛查儿童血铅水平,能及早发现儿童铅中毒,可达到预防、提早干预和治疗的目的 ,提高本地区儿童的健康水平.方法 对2168名12岁以内儿童的血铅筛查资料进行了归纳、分析.结果 2168例儿童当中血铅≥200 μg/L(0.97 μmol/L)的儿童共159名,占总检查人数的7.33%,均为轻到中度中毒,且多表现不典型.多数患儿能找出铅接触危险因素,中毒程度与多重危险因素相关.惠儿均给予去除铅接触危险因素、营养指导等处理,2~3个月后复查血铅,其血铅水平均有不同程度下降.结论 儿童铅中毒是完全可以预防的,通过环境干预、开展健康教育、有重点的筛查和监测等措施,可以预防和早发现、早干预儿童铅中毒.  相似文献

The relationship of blood lead concentration to stature was evaluated by examining data from a sample of 1454 Mexican-American children aged 5-12 y, derived from the data sets of the Hispanic Health and Nutrition Examination Survey (HHANES) conducted in 1982-1984. The results indicate that there is an inverse relationship between blood lead concentration in the range 0.14-1.92 mumol/L with stature. The present finding suggests that growth retardation may be associated even with moderate concentrations of blood lead. Therefore, permissible exposure levels of lead for children deserve reexamination in light of the present analysis.  相似文献

学龄前儿童血铅水平与体液免疫关系分析   总被引:1,自引:0,他引:1  
目的探讨血铅水平对学龄前儿童体液免疫影响。方法用石墨炉原子吸收光谱法对917名学龄前儿童进行血铅测定,根据血铅水平设立高铅组和低铅组(对照组),分别对两组儿童用免疫比浊法进行免疫球蛋白5项(IgA、IgG、IgM、C3和C4)测定,高铅组及对照组均给予补钙剂(排铅方法之一),3个月后两组儿童再次进行免疫球蛋白5项测定,高铅组重新进行血铅水平测定。结果3个月后,高铅组血铅水平由原来的(143.5±12.1)μg/L下降到(92.6±8.9)μg/L(P<0.05),免疫球蛋白IgA、IgG及C3水平分别由治疗前的(0.64±0.15)g/L、(6.21±1.38)g/L和(1.02±0.26)g/L升高到(0.95±0.31)g/L、(9.56±2.16)g/L和(1.12±0.28)g/L(P<0.05);对照组免疫球蛋白IgA、IgG及C3水平与补钙前比较差异无统计学意义(P>0.05)。结论高血铅对学龄前儿童体液免疫功能有一定的影响,且补钙是一种安全有效的排铅方法之一。  相似文献

Objective: To assess the impact of airborne lead dust on blood lead levels in residents of Esperance, a regional Western Australian town, with particular reference to preschool children. Methods: Following identification of significant airborne lead contamination, residents were notified that a blood lead clinic was available to all, with testing of preschool children encouraged. About 40% (333 children) of the preschool group and about 20% of the remaining population were tested. The main measures were blood lead levels, prevalence of elevated results and comparisons to other Western Australian surveys. Results: In preschoolers, 2.1% (seven children) had blood lead levels exceeding the current 10 μg/dL level of concern. This was not significantly different to two previous community‐based surveys elsewhere in Western Australia. However, at a lower cut‐off of 5 μg/dL, the prevalence of elevated lead levels was 24.6%, significantly higher than children tested in a previous Western Australian survey. The prevalence of blood lead levels of 10 μg/dL or greater in adults was 1.3% (26 adults), not significantly different from a previous Western Australian survey. Conclusions: The prevalence of preschool children with blood lead levels exceeding the current level of concern was not significantly increased. However, the increased prevalence of children with lead levels at or above 5 μg/dL demonstrates exposure to lead dust pollution. Implications: This episode of lead dust contamination highlights the need for strict adherence to environmental controls and effective monitoring processes to ensure the prevention of future events.  相似文献

韶关市2~6岁1 139名儿童血铅水平及影响因素的分析   总被引:2,自引:1,他引:2  
【目的】了解韶关市2~6岁儿童血铅水平分布特点及影响因素,以期为做好儿童保健工作提供依据。【方法】根据韶关市布局特点,随机抽取居民、近郊、交通繁忙及厂矿区8个幼儿园1139名2~6岁儿童为调查对象,采指端末梢血20μl,用钨舟原子吸收光谱法.测定血铅水平,并进行问卷调查。【结果】2~6岁1130名儿童血铅水平均值为0.47μmol/L,铅中毒率30.955%,以轻度铅中毒者居多(38.02%);男、女童血铅水平及铅中毒率差异无显著性;随年龄的增加.铅中毒率逐渐增高。5岁组血铅水平、铅中毒率最高;近郊及厂矿区血铅水平,铅中毒率较高;不良卫生习惯、铅作业家庭成员、被动吸烟是影响血铅的高危因素,常用乳类食品则是保护因素。【结论】韶关市近郊及厂矿区儿童是高危人群15岁左右可能是铅暴露的关键时期;不良卫生习惯和环境因素增加铅吸收风险。  相似文献

Abstract: To investigate the distribution of blood lead levels in a sample of Victorian children, and to compare current levels with those from a similar survey in 1979, blood was tested for lead in 252 children (123 under five years) attending Royal Children's Hospital as outpatients and having venepuncture blood samples for medical reasons. Blood lead levels were determined by graphite furnace atomic absorption spectrophotometer. The mean blood lead level was 0.26 μmol/L (5.4 μg/dL). In the under-five age group, the mean was 0.28 μmol/L (5.7 μg/dL). Only 1.6 per cent of this group exceeded the National Health and Medical Research Council action level of 0.72 μmol/L (15 μg/dL). Levels in this age group have declined significantly since 1979, when the mean was 0.54 μmol/L (11.1 μg/dL) and 12.9 per cent exceeded 0.72 μmol/L (15 μg/dL). Average blood lead levels have halved since 1979, with likely contributing factors being reduced exposure from lead in diet, reduced access to lead in paint and reduced lead in ambient air. Children with elevated levels had identifiable risk factors such as pica or exposure to lead-based paint, suggesting the need for ongoing public health action to prevent exposure in these groups.  相似文献

目的:检测学龄前儿童末稍血中钙、铁、锌、镁、铜元素的水平,为预防疾病提供科学依据。方法:采用MP-2型溶出分析法检测。结果:各种元素构成比正常;<2岁组、2~5岁组、>5岁组儿童钙、铁、锌、铜构成比比较差异无统计学意义(P>0.05);镁元素在3个年龄组儿童构成比比较差异有统计学意义,>5岁组与≤5岁组比较差异有统计学意义,镁元素缺乏率高。结论:营养素钙、铁、锌、铜在学龄前儿童体内的分布合理;镁元素的缺乏在学龄前儿童中占有一定的比例,机体可存在长期缺镁而无低镁血症现象,建议将营养素的检测纳入学龄前儿童保健常规检查项目。  相似文献

学龄前儿童发铅水平及其对健康影响的调查   总被引:1,自引:0,他引:1  
目的了解广州市儿童发铅水平及其对健康的影响。方法采用多阶段随机抽样方法抽取广州市学龄前儿童作为调查对象,采用WFS-130型原子吸收分光光度法测量儿童的发铅含量,并对其健康状况和相关因素进行问卷调查。结果调查对象的平均发铅含量为8.642±2.509ug/g,发铅含量超标率为35.1%,儿童发铅含量随着年龄增加而降低。发铅含量超标的儿童经常使用彩色笔颜料和经常使用彩色餐饮具的比例分别为39.3%和29.0%,高于发铅含量正常的儿童。在工厂区生活的儿童的发铅含量超标率为40.5%,高于生活在其他环境的儿童。发铅含量超标儿童患多动症者、记忆和思考能力差的发生率分别为20.8%、7.63%,高于发铅正常儿童。结论儿童行为习惯和生活环境与其发铅含量有关,儿童发铅含量高对其健康状况有影响,应引起重视。  相似文献

目的 探讨环境铅暴露对学龄前儿童血铅及脂质过氧化水平的影响.方法 采用分层整群抽样法,抽取辽宁省鞍山市5所托幼机构的408名学龄前儿童,其中男童217名,女童192名.检测血铅、全血δ-氨基γ-戊二酸脱水酶(ALAD)、超氧化物歧化酶(SOD)、还原型谷胱甘肽(GSH)、谷胱甘肽过氧化物酶(GSH-Px)和血清丙二醛(MDA).结果 鞍山市儿童铅中毒发生率为27.4%;血铅≥100 μg/L的儿童ALAD活性为(644.50±146.17)u/(g·Hb),与血铅<100μg/L的儿童比较明显降低,MDA水平达(5.875±0.818)nmol/ml,与血铅<100μg/L的儿童比较明显升高;被调查儿童的SOD、GSH-Px、GSH水平与血铅升高无关联.结论 ALAD和MDA是反映铅致氧化损伤的敏感指标.  相似文献

目的了解芜湖市市区学龄前儿童血铅水平,为提出针对性干预措施提供科学依据。方法对561名3~6岁儿童采左手无名指末梢血,采用电极溶出法进行血铅测定,并进行相关因素问卷调查。结果 561名儿童血铅值在0.15~194.44ug/l之间,平均54.43±39.82ug/l,儿童铅中毒检出率为14.08%,男女检出率差异无统计学意义(P〉0.05),各年龄组儿童铅水平差异有统计学意义(P〈0.05),检出率随年龄增长而升高。儿童铅中毒可引起儿童注意力不集中、攻击性、挑食、情绪不稳等。结论芜湖市市区学龄前儿童存在铅中毒,应加强血铅防控工作。  相似文献

Effect of interventions on children's blood lead levels.   总被引:2,自引:1,他引:1       下载免费PDF全文
Trail, Canada, has been the site of an active lead/zinc smelter for nearly a century. Since 1991, the Trail Community Lead Task Force has carried out blood lead screening, case management, education programs targeted at early childhood groups and the general community, community dust abatement, exposure pathways studies, and remedial trials. From 1989 through 1996, average blood lead levels of children tested for the first time declined at an average rate of 0.6 microg/dl/year, while blood lead levels in Canadian children not living near point sources appeared to be leveling off following the phase-out of leaded gasoline. Since there was no concurrent improvement in local environmental conditions during this time, it is possible that the continuing decline in Trail blood lead levels has been at least partly due to community-wide intervention programs. One year follow-up of children whose families received in-home educational visits, as well as assistance with home-based dust control measures, found that these specific interventions produced average blood lead changes of +0.5- -4.0 microg/dl, with statistically significant declines in 3 years out of 5. Education and dust control, particularly actions targeted toward higher risk children, appear to have served as effective and appropriate interim remedial measures while major source control measures have been implemented at the smelter site.  相似文献

目的:了解长沙市儿童血铅水平。方法:采用日本日立公司Z-2700石墨炉原子吸收光谱仪对1755例0~12岁健康体检儿童进行血铅检测。结果:1755名儿童中高铅血症检出率为10.6%,血铅平均值66.6μg/L,其中男童检出率为11.0%,女童检出率为10.2%;城市儿童检出率为8.0%,农村儿童检出率为13.9%,农村明显高于城市,差异有统计学意义(P<0.05);各年龄组中幼儿组高铅血症检出率最高14.2%,学龄前组次之12.5%,学龄组8.4%及婴儿组7.2%检出率相对较低。结论:应加强铅中毒危害知识的宣传教育,尤其应针对农村地区及婴幼儿的家长开展相关健康宣教,预防儿童铅中毒发生。  相似文献
